Why Traditional PR Is No Longer Enough

Public relations remains one of the most effective ways to build credibility. Media coverage, thought leadership, and corporate communications all contribute to strengthening a brand’s reputation.

However, modern consumers rarely interact with a brand through a single channel.

A customer might first discover your company through an online article, then visit your social media profiles, watch an influencer review, attend a launch event, and finally search Google before making a purchasing decision.

If these touchpoints aren’t connected, valuable opportunities are lost.

An integrated marketing strategy ensures every communication channel reinforces the same message, creating a consistent customer journey that builds confidence at every stage.

For businesses operating in Thailand, this approach is particularly important because of the country’s relationship-driven business culture and highly active digital ecosystem.

Why Thailand Requires a Localized Communication Strategy

Although global marketing frameworks provide useful guidance, successful campaigns in Thailand require local adaptation.

Several factors make the Thai market unique:

  • Strong relationships between journalists, businesses, and opinion leaders
  • High social media engagement across platforms such as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, LINE, and X
  • Consumer expectations for localized language and culturally relevant messaging
  • Growing influence of Key Opinion Leaders (KOLs) throughout the purchasing journey

Working with a local agency allows brands to communicate in ways that resonate with Thai audiences while avoiding cultural misunderstandings and maximizing media opportunities.

What is the difference between PR and digital marketing?

Public relations focuses on earning credibility through media coverage and reputation management, while digital marketing promotes brands through owned and paid channels. Combining both approaches delivers stronger and more sustainable results.
